Common Causes of Wilting Leaves
π§ Water Stress
Water stress is a primary culprit behind wilting leaves in Globe Thistle. Symptoms include drooping leaves, dry soil, and browning edges, signaling that your plant is thirsty.
Inconsistent watering or prolonged drought can lead to this stress. It's crucial to establish a regular watering routine to keep your Globe Thistle hydrated.
βοΈ Heat Stress
Heat stress can also wreak havoc on your Globe Thistle. Look for signs like curling leaves, wilting during peak sun hours, and a scorched appearance.
Extreme temperatures or insufficient shade during hot weather are common causes. Providing adequate protection can help your plant thrive even in the heat.
π¦ Disease-Related Wilting
While itβs tempting to consider disease when you see wilting, pathogenic wilt is rare in Globe Thistle. Instead, focus on environmental factors first to diagnose the issue effectively.

Diagnosing Wilting
π΅οΈββοΈ Step-by-Step Guide to Diagnose Wilting
Diagnosing wilting in your Globe Thistle is straightforward. Start by checking the soil moisture; use a moisture meter or your finger to gauge how damp the soil is.
Next, observe the environmental conditions. Take note of the temperature, humidity, and sunlight exposure your plant is receiving.
Inspect for pests as well. Look closely for any signs of infestation on the leaves and stems that could be affecting your plant's health.
Finally, evaluate any recent care changes. Consider if you've altered your watering, fertilization, or if the plant has been relocated recently.
π Signs to Look for in Wilting
Pay attention to leaf color changes. Yellowing or browning leaves can indicate stress.
Also, examine the leaf texture. Are they dry, crispy, or mushy? These textures can reveal a lot about the plant's condition.
Overall plant vigor is crucial too. If you notice stunted growth or a lack of flowering, it may be time to take action.

Solutions for Wilting
π§ Actionable Advice for Water Stress
Water stress is a common issue for Globe Thistle. To combat this, establish a consistent watering schedule; ensure you water deeply when the top inch of soil feels dry.
Using well-draining soil is crucial. This prevents waterlogging, which can lead to root rot and further wilting.
βοΈ Actionable Advice for Heat Stress
Heat stress can be detrimental, especially during peak sun hours. To protect your Globe Thistle, provide shade using shade cloth to shield it from intense sunlight.
Additionally, applying a layer of mulch helps retain soil moisture and regulates temperature. This simple step can make a significant difference in your plant's health.
π¦ Actionable Advice for Disease-Related Wilting
While disease-related wilting is rare, itβs essential to stay vigilant. Start by identifying and removing any affected parts; pruning diseased leaves or stems can help prevent further issues.
Improving air circulation around your plants is also vital. Space them adequately to reduce humidity, which can lead to fungal problems and other diseases.

Preventive Measures
Tips to Minimize Future Wilting Episodes π±
Regular monitoring is key to keeping your Globe Thistle thriving. Check soil moisture and overall plant health weekly to catch any issues early.
Adjust your watering based on the weather. Increase frequency during hot, dry spells to ensure your plant stays hydrated.
Best Practices for Globe Thistle Care πΌ
Choosing the right planting location is crucial. Globe Thistles thrive in full sun with well-drained soil, so pick a spot that meets these needs.
Fertilization can also make a big difference. Use a balanced fertilizer during the growing season to promote robust growth and resilience against stressors.

Reviving a Wilted Globe Thistle
π Techniques for Bottom Watering
Bottom watering is a simple yet effective method to revive your wilted Globe Thistle. Just place the pot in a shallow tray filled with water for about 30 minutes, allowing the roots to soak up the moisture they desperately need.
π³ Temporary Relocation Strategies
If the heat is too intense, consider relocating your plant to a shaded area. This temporary move can significantly reduce stress and help your Globe Thistle recover from the harsh sun.
βοΈ Pruning Damaged Leaves
Pruning is essential for encouraging new growth in wilted plants. Use clean, sharp pruning shears to cut back any wilted or damaged leaves, promoting healthier foliage and a more vibrant plant.
